Normalize handling amphibians with gloves! If you're handling wild amphibians (especially if you handle multiple consecutively) this also helps prevent the spread of the deadly chytrid fungal disease that has caused the extinction or decline of dozens of species.

@frogclubs @mahalshei I just want to clarify that not all tree frogs are arboreal. Spring peepers, cricket frogs, and chorus frogs for example are in the hylidae family and they aren't arboreal.
